The Test Setup
Our testing methodology involved a robot hitting 54 shots per club across nine face zones, ensuring a comprehensive evaluation. This approach allowed us to capture performance on both ideal and less-than-perfect swings, providing a realistic assessment of each driver's capabilities.

Breaking the Mold
Traditionally, low-spin drivers with a forward CG excel in speed but struggle with forgiveness. The G440 LST defies this stereotype. It achieves remarkable speed while maintaining stability, a feat that challenges the very essence of driver design.
Carry Distance Conundrum
The carry heat map reveals the G440 LST's resilience. It maintains impressive carry distances on low-toe and low-heel misses, areas where drivers often falter. This level of forgiveness in a low-spin design is unprecedented and raises questions about the boundaries of driver technology.
Spin Stability Secrets
Our SDEI (Spin Degradation Index) metric highlights the G440 LST's spin consistency. It manages spin degradation better than its predecessor, showcasing a refined design that doesn't compromise speed for stability.
Dispersion Insights
Dispersion data tells a fascinating story. The G440 LST's dispersion footprint is remarkably similar to the G440 K, a max-forgiveness head. This suggests that Ping has achieved a delicate balance between speed and forgiveness, challenging the notion that these traits are mutually exclusive.
